Absorbing Fats - Bile in Action
from Chemistry in Everyday Life · host Johannes Vogel
After talking about red blood cells two episodes ago, this episode looks at a different bodily fluid. One that helps in the digestion of fats. We are talking about bile. A liquid associated with bad experiences, but is essential to our survival.
